บันทึกการอัพเดท UX ของบล็อกเล็กๆ น้อยๆ

tags: note
31 ส.ค. 68

ในรอบปีที่ผ่านมา Vibe Coding หรือจะเรียกให้ดีหน่อยก็ AI Assisted Coding ได้มีการพัฒนาอย่างก้าวกระโดดมากๆ จนนำมาใช้ช่วยงานอย่างหลากหลายได้จริง ประกอบกับที่เราเองก็คิดอะไรเรื่อยเปื่อยสรรหาเขียนโค้ดในเวลาว่างอันแสนจะน้อยนิดในช่วงวันหยุด ก็เลยคิดขึ้นมาว่าอยากจะแก้บล็อกสักนิด และไหนๆ ก็ไหนๆ แล้วก็เขียนบล็อกบันทึกไว้สักหน่อยละกัน

วกมาที่เรื่อง UX ซึ่งจริงๆ เราก็ไม่ได้เป็นผู้เชี่ยวชาญอะไร เรียกได้ว่าเป็น Gut Feeling ล้วนๆ คือก็เปิดบล็อกตัวเองดูแล้วก็ไถไปไถมาก็รู้สึกว่า เออ เราก็ไม่ได้เขียนมาเยอะเท่าไหร่ บางปีก็ไม่ได้เขียนด้วยซ้ำ แต่มันก็เยอะขึ้นเรื่อยๆ นะ นี่ก็ครบ 10 ปีแล้ว แล้วอีก 10 ปีก็คงเยอะขึ้นอีกมั้ง หรือเราควรเพิ่ม Pagination เข้ามาดี คิดๆ ไปก็นึกขึ้นได้ว่าเรามีฟิลเตอร์ปีอยู่แล้วนี่หว่า เอามาใช้ทำ Pagination ไปเลยละกัน แล้วเวลาเปิดบล็อกมาถ้าปีนั้นๆ เขียนน้อยก็จะได้เตือนใจว่าเขียนเพิ่มหน่อยมั้ยอะไรงี้ ก็เลยบอกตัวเองแบบหลวมๆ ว่าสักปีละ 3 โพสต์ก็ยังดีนะ 😌

คิดเสร็จก็บอก GitHub Copilot แก้ไปเป็นชั่วโมงอยู่ รอบแรกแก้เสร็จแล้วแต่ต้องใช้ SSR เพราะ SSG Astro มันไม่รองรับ Query Params แต่พอเอาขึ้น Cloudflare ก็ไปเจอปัญหาทำให้ต้องกลับมาเขียนใหม่ให้มันอยู่บน Client Side แทน ก็ถือว่าได้ดังใจอยู่ แต่คิดตามหลัก UX/UI แล้วก็ไม่รู้เหมือนกันว่ามันโอเคมั้ย บล็อกนี้ถือว่าเป็น Product เดียวที่ดีไซน์เอง ก็เลยช่างมันละกันเอาที่ใช้เองแล้วได้ดังใจก็พอ 😬

บันทึกไว้อีกสักประเด็นทิ้งท้าย เอาเข้าจริงการเขียนบล็อกนี่ก็ไม่ได้คาดหวังว่าจะต้องมีคนอื่นมาอ่านเรื่องที่เราอยากแชร์สักเท่าไหร่ เพราะหลังๆ มานี่รู้สึกว่าเปิดดูบล็อกเก่าๆ ของตัวเองแล้วก็สนุกดีเหมือนกัน บางอันก็ตลก บางอันก็เศร้า ถึงแม้ส่วนใหญ่สาระไม่ค่อยมีแต่มันก็สะท้อนอะไรหลายๆ อย่างในช่วงเวลานั้นๆ ได้ดีเหมือนกัน อย่างบล็อกก่อนหน้าที่ก็มาอัพเดทเพราะตกอยู่ในมรสุมชีวิต Midlife Crisis ที่ก่อเองคิดมากเองกลัวเอง แต่ในที่สุดตอนนี้ก็เหมือนจะผ่านมันมาได้แล้ว ก็ถือว่าเราเองก็คงเติบโตขึ้นอีกขั้นล่ะมั้ง ช่วงนี้ไอตัวเล็กก็กรี๊ดเก่งมาก มีช่วงเวลาที่หัวเราะเยอะๆ กับช่วงเวลาที่มีสมาธิมากขึ้น โดยรวมก็ถือว่าเครียดน้อยลงมากๆ แล้วล่ะนะ รีบโตมาเป็นเพื่อนเล่นกับพ่อนะลูกนะ

blog